Kotlin弦 (Kotlin String)
String is an array of characters. Kotlin Strings are more or less similar to the Java Strings, but with some new add-ons. Following is the syntax to define a string.
字符串是字符数组。 Kotlin字符串或多或少类似于Java字符串,但带有一些新的附加组件。 以下是定义字符串的语法。
var str: String = "Hello"
//or
var str = "Hello"
var newString: String = 'A' //ERROR
var newString: String = 2 //ERROR
String in Kotlin is implemented using the String class. Like Java String, Kotlin Strings are immutable.
Kotlin中的String是使用String类实现的。 像Java String一样,Kotlin Strings是不可变的。
var str = "Hello"
str += "Kotlin Strings"
The above declaration changes the reference of the variable str in the second line to the newly created string(“Hello Kotlin Strings”) in the String Pool.
上面的声明将第二行中变量str的引用更改为String Pool中新创建的字符串(“ Hello Kotlin Strings”)。
Creating an empty String
创建一个空字符串
var s = String() //creates an empty string.
Unlike Java, Kotlin doesn’t require a new keyword to instantiate an object of a class.
与Java不同,Kotlin不需要new关键字来实例化类的对象。

访问字符串中的字符 (Accessing Characters in a String)
To access individual characters of a String, Kotlin supports the index access operator(Unlike Java) as shown below.
Using Index Operator
要访问String的各个字符,Kotlin支持索引访问运算符(不同于Java),如下所示。
使用索引运算符
var str = "Hello, Kotlin"
print(str[0]) //prints H
Using the get method
使用get方法
val str = "Hello Kotlin Strings"
println(str.get(4)) //prints o
Iterating through a String
We can loop through a string to access each character using a for-in loop as shown below.
遍历字符串
我们可以使用for-in循环遍历字符串以访问每个字符,如下所示。
for(element in str){
println(element)
}

In Java, we commonly override toString() method of a class to display the contents of the class’s instance object. Similar stuff happens in Kotlin too as shown below.
在Java中,我们通常重写类的toString()方法以显示该类的实例对象的内容。 如下所示,在Kotlin中也发生了类似的事情。
class Student(var name: String, var age: Int) { //Define properties and functions here. } //The following code is written inside the main function of the Kotlin class. var student = Student("Anupam", 23) print(student) //prints com.journaldev.Strings.Student@34a245abPrinting the above object doesn’t give any idea about the variables initialised.
Here’s where we override thetoString()method as shown below.打印上面的对象不会对初始化的变量有任何想法。
此处是我们重写toString()方法的地方,如下所示。class Student(var name: String, var age: Int) { override fun toString(): String { return "Student name is $name and age is $age" } } //The following code is written inside the main function of the Kotlin class. var student = Student("Anupam", 23) print(student) //prints Student name is Anupam and age is 23Note: Unlike Java, Kotlin doesn’t require a

new关键字即可初始化类的构造函数。字符串相等 (String Equality)
There are two types of equality checkers.
有两种类型的相等性检查器。
- Referential Equality: Checks if the pointers for two objects are the same.
===operator is used. 引用相等 :检查两个对象的指针是否相同。===运算符。 - Structural Equality : Checks if the contents of both the objects are equal.
==is used. 结构相等 :检查两个对象的内容是否相等。==被使用。
Following code snippet demonstrates the above checkers.
以下代码段演示了上述检查器。
var a = "Hello" var b = "Hello again" var c = "Hello" var d1 = "Hel" var d2 ="lo" var d = d1 + d2 println(a===c) // true since a and c objects point to the same String in the StringPool println(a==c) //true since contents are equal println(a===b) //false println(a==b) //false println(a===d) //false since d is made up of two different Strings. Hence a and d point to different set of strings println(a==d) //true since the contents are equalNote: The negation of === and == are !=== and !== respectively.
